Secondary school student commit suicide in Benue

One Terhemba Tyochivir has killed himself in Benue, the police in the middle-belt state have disclosed.

The incident happened in Makurdi, the state capital, on Thursday.

The state police public relations officer, SP Sewuese Anene, made the disclosure in statement.

She said before his death, he was a student at Government Secondary School, Gboko.

Anene said the details of the incident remained hazy even though it was reported at the E Division Police Station, Makurdi.

She said the deceased was rushed to Bishop Murray Hospital Makurdi, where doctors confirmed him dead.

The deceased’s father, Kula Tyochivir, turned down requests from journalist to speak with him.

In a related development, last week, a 17-year-old boy, Betwom Bitrus, reportedly committed suicide in Bauchi state.

The incident happened at Bombar in Bogoro Local Government Area of the state.

The Police Public Relations Officer, Bauchi State Command, Ahmed Wakil, a Superintendent of Police, confirmed the incident to newsmen on Wednesday.

According to Wakil, the deceased was said to have left home to go to a stream in the area to take his bath but did not return home.
